  • The first such component is the maintainer ability to spontaneously and manually hide/reveal resources from an access (or similar) role, ideally through a single click (i.e. not having to go to a new screen).
  • The second component is the ability to schedule this hide/reveal operation, which could not be accomplished through a single click.

Potential pitfalls

What happens when resources that are attached in other tools (like Announcements or Schedule events) are hidden? They will be inaccessible, but how can this be handled so that the site maintainer does not unwittingly create new problems for themselves?

Use Cases

  • An instructor wants to pre-load all her resources at the beginning of the term, but organized into one folder for each week of class, and each folder is automatically "turned on" at the beginning of each week.
  • An instructor wants to upload exam solutions to the site, but set them to be visible only at midnight following the exam day.
  • An instructor wants "stale" content to disappear from the student's view after two weeks, yet still wants to keep the content visible to teaching assistants and instructors of the site.
  • An instructor wants to upload lecture notes for an entire term in one go, but set them to be revealed to students only after the scheduled lecture.
  • An instructor may want to post answer sets to homework assignments, but only make them available after the due date of the homework, and yet would like to have them all uploaded and available for teaching assistants at the beginning of the semester.

  1. A site maintainer should be able to set any given resource to be hidden from 'access' roles (e.g. students) but visible to others (e.g. instructors and TAs).
  2. Content thus hidden should also not be visible through a WebDAV connection for an 'access' role (i.e. WebDAV should not present a security hole).
  3. When the content is uploaded the option must be available for it to be automatically hidden. It should not be necessary to have the file exposed for a period of time until a subsequent action is taken to hide it. WebDAV uploads should be similarly covered.
  4. A site maintainer should be able to constrain "start" and "end" dates and times for an item's visibility (i.e. to schedule this in advance).
  5. A site maintainer should be able to indicate just one or both of the start and end date properties. Using one property should not require the other.
  6. There should be some visual indication of which resources are currently 'hidden,' when the instructor/TA views the resources.
  7. This functionality has no meaning within a "MyWorkspace", and should not be available there.
